pragma solidity ^0.8.10; import "@openzeppelin/contracts/utils/math/SafeMath.sol"; import "@openzeppelin/contracts/token/ERC20/ERC20.sol"; import "@openzeppelin/contracts/token/ERC20/utils/SafeERC20.sol"; import "@openzeppelin/contracts/security/ReentrancyGuard.sol"; // Inheritance import "./RewardsDistributionRecipient.sol"; import "@openzeppelin/contracts/security/Pausable.sol"; contract StakingRewards is RewardsDistributionRecipient, ReentrancyGuard, Pausable { using SafeMath for uint256; using SafeERC20 for IERC20; /* ========== STATE VARIABLES ========== */ address public stakingAddress; IERC20 public GAI; uint256 public periodFinish = 0; uint256 public rewardRate = 0; uint256 public rewardsDuration = 30 days; uint256 public lastUpdateTime; uint256 public rewardPerTokenStored; mapping(address => uint256) public userRewardPerTokenPaid; mapping(address => uint256) public rewards; mapping(address => uint256) public startOfUserStake; uint256 private _totalSupply; mapping(address => uint256) private _balances; /* ========== CONSTRUCTOR ========== */ constructor( address _rewardsDistribution, address _GAI, address _stakingAddress ) public { GAI = IERC20(_GAI); rewardsDistribution = _rewardsDistribution; stakingAddress = _stakingAddress; } /* ========== VIEWS ========== */ function totalSupply() external view returns (uint256) { return _totalSupply; } function balanceOf(address account) external view returns (uint256) { return _balances[account]; } function lastTimeRewardApplicable() public view returns (uint256) { return block.timestamp < periodFinish ? block.timestamp : periodFinish; } function rewardPerToken() public view returns (uint256) { if (_totalSupply == 0) { return rewardPerTokenStored; } return rewardPerTokenStored.add( lastTimeRewardApplicable().sub(lastUpdateTime).mul(rewardRate).mul(1e18).div( _totalSupply ) ); } function earned(address account) public view returns (uint256) { return _balances[account] .mul(rewardPerToken().sub(userRewardPerTokenPaid[account])) .div(1e18) .add(rewards[account]); } function getRewardForDuration() external view returns (uint256) { return rewardRate.mul(rewardsDuration); } /* ========== MUTATIVE FUNCTIONS ========== */ function stake(uint256 amount) external nonReentrant whenNotPaused updateReward(msg.sender) { require(amount > 0, "Cannot stake 0"); _totalSupply = _totalSupply.add(amount); _balances[msg.sender] = _balances[msg.sender].add(amount); GAI.safeTransferFrom(msg.sender, stakingAddress, amount); startOfUserStake[msg.sender] = block.timestamp; emit Staked(msg.sender, amount); } function withdraw(uint256 amount) public nonReentrant whenNotPaused updateReward(msg.sender) { require(amount > 0, "Cannot withdraw 0"); require( startOfUserStake[msg.sender] <= block.timestamp.sub(rewardsDuration), "Your stake must be from at least one epoch ago" ); _totalSupply = _totalSupply.sub(amount); _balances[msg.sender] = _balances[msg.sender].sub(amount); GAI.safeTransferFrom(stakingAddress, msg.sender, amount); emit Withdrawn(msg.sender, amount); } function getReward() public nonReentrant updateReward(msg.sender) { uint256 reward = rewards[msg.sender]; if (reward > 0) { rewards[msg.sender] = 0; GAI.safeTransfer(msg.sender, reward); emit RewardPaid(msg.sender, reward); } } function exit() external { withdraw(_balances[msg.sender]); getReward(); } /* ========== RESTRICTED FUNCTIONS ========== */ function notifyRewardAmount(uint256 reward) external override onlyRewardsDistribution updateReward(address(0)) { if (block.timestamp >= periodFinish) { rewardRate = reward.div(rewardsDuration); } else { uint256 remaining = periodFinish.sub(block.timestamp); uint256 leftover = remaining.mul(rewardRate); rewardRate = reward.add(leftover).div(rewardsDuration); } // Ensure the provided reward amount is not more than the balance in the contract. // This keeps the reward rate in the right range, preventing overflows due to // very high values of rewardRate in the earned and rewardsPerToken functions; // Reward + leftover must be less than 2^256 / 10^18 to avoid overflow. uint256 balance = GAI.balanceOf(address(this)); require(rewardRate <= balance.div(rewardsDuration), "Provided reward too high"); lastUpdateTime = block.timestamp; periodFinish = block.timestamp.add(rewardsDuration); emit RewardAdded(reward); } // Added to support recovering LP Rewards from other systems such as BAL to be distributed to holders function recoverERC20(address tokenAddress, uint256 tokenAmount) external onlyOwner { require(tokenAddress != address(GAI), "Cannot withdraw the staking token"); IERC20(tokenAddress).safeTransfer(owner(), tokenAmount); emit Recovered(tokenAddress, tokenAmount); } function setRewardsDuration(uint256 _rewardsDuration) external onlyOwner { require( block.timestamp > periodFinish, "Previous rewards period must be complete before changing the duration for the new period" ); rewardsDuration = _rewardsDuration; emit RewardsDurationUpdated(rewardsDuration); } function Pause() external onlyOwner { _pause(); } function UnPause() external onlyOwner { _unpause(); } /* ========== MODIFIERS ========== */ modifier updateReward(address account) { rewardPerTokenStored = rewardPerToken(); lastUpdateTime = lastTimeRewardApplicable(); if (account != address(0)) { rewards[account] = earned(account); userRewardPerTokenPaid[account] = rewardPerTokenStored; } _; } /* ========== EVENTS ========== */ event RewardAdded(uint256 reward); event Staked(address indexed user, uint256 amount); event Withdrawn(address indexed user, uint256 amount); event RewardPaid(address indexed user, uint256 reward); event RewardsDurationUpdated(uint256 newDuration); event Recovered(address token, uint256 amount); }

// SPDX-License-Identifier: MIT // OpenZeppelin Contracts v4.4.1 (security/ReentrancyGuard.sol) pragma solidity ^0.8.0; /** * @dev Contract module that helps prevent reentrant calls to a function. * * Inheriting from `ReentrancyGuard` will make the {nonReentrant} modifier * available, which can be applied to functions to make sure there are no nested * (reentrant) calls to them. * * Note that because there is a single `nonReentrant` guard, functions marked as * `nonReentrant` may not call one another. This can be worked around by making * those functions `private`, and then adding `external` `nonReentrant` entry * points to them. * * TIP: If you would like to learn more about reentrancy and alternative ways * to protect against it, check out our blog post * https://blog.openzeppelin.com/reentrancy-after-istanbul/[Reentrancy After Istanbul]. */ abstract contract ReentrancyGuard { // Booleans are more expensive than uint256 or any type that takes up a full // word because each write operation emits an extra SLOAD to first read the // slot's contents, replace the bits taken up by the boolean, and then write // back. This is the compiler's defense against contract upgrades and // pointer aliasing, and it cannot be disabled. // The values being non-zero value makes deployment a bit more expensive, // but in exchange the refund on every call to nonReentrant will be lower in // amount. Since refunds are capped to a percentage of the total // transaction's gas, it is best to keep them low in cases like this one, to // increase the likelihood of the full refund coming into effect. uint256 private constant _NOT_ENTERED = 1; uint256 private constant _ENTERED = 2; uint256 private _status; constructor() { _status = _NOT_ENTERED; } /** * @dev Prevents a contract from calling itself, directly or indirectly. * Calling a `nonReentrant` function from another `nonReentrant` * function is not supported. It is possible to prevent this from happening * by making the `nonReentrant` function external, and making it call a * `private` function that does the actual work. */ modifier nonReentrant() { // On the first call to nonReentrant, _notEntered will be true require(_status != _ENTERED, "ReentrancyGuard: reentrant call"); // Any calls to nonReentrant after this point will fail _status = _ENTERED; _; // By storing the original value once again, a refund is triggered (see // https://eips.ethereum.org/EIPS/eip-2200) _status = _NOT_ENTERED; } }
